Fractal in Fatigue Fractography

摘要 Fracture profile roughnesses and fractal dimensions of fracture traces were measured on a fatigued Ti-6Al-4V alloy.It is found that although fractal dimension can well reflect the variation of fracture traces with the measuring units,it is difficult to apply it to quantitative analysis of fractured surfaces because of the dependence of the meas- ured profile roughness on the measuring units.Based on fractal concept.an alternative equation lgR_l(η)=lgR_o-(D-1)lgη was obtained.in which we intro- duced a parameter of intrinsic profile roughness to evalu- ate fracture profile roughness without restriction of the measuring units employed.
